Output 63c6fc63209d697deecc679969982b1d3d43a3115242de67b94e028334cbb77d:0

value
2100360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cae2cecca6d3d84cc1b71562aad9d8a9dfe0c44 OP_EQUAL
address
3MosEfuFsLyZRnBZnW5fiaDN1Gouh6dtnZ
transaction
63c6fc63209d697deecc679969982b1d3d43a3115242de67b94e028334cbb77d
confirmations
296780
spent
true